Meet Cheddar, The One-in-30-Million Orange Lobster
Featured in Ripley's Believe It or Not!
There was something obviously very different about one of the lobsters shipped to a Red Lobster restaurant in Hollywood, Florida. Employees at the restaurant immediately noticed the beautiful, bright orange color of the lobster, and they went on a mission to rescue the unique crustacean.